Information on Sky Satellite

The term "Sky Satellite" refers to a range of digital television services offered by BSkyB (British Sky Broadcasting).
     BSkyB, operating in the United Kingdom, is both a network operator (through its satellite system) and a content provider through its eleven channels. These channels include: Sky One, Sky News, Sky Travel, the Sky Sports channels and the Sky Movies channels.
